Key Ingredients for Your Spicy Mango Margarita
Creating an exceptional spicy mango margarita starts with high-quality ingredients. Here’s a closer look at what you’ll need and some tips for selection:
- Mango: Fresh mango is absolutely essential for the best flavor and texture. Choose a ripe mango that yields slightly to gentle pressure. Peel and dice it before use. If fresh mango isn’t available, see our FAQs below for guidance on using frozen mango, though we always recommend fresh for superior taste.
- Jalapeño: This is where the “spicy” in our margarita comes from! You can easily adjust the heat level to your preference. For a milder spice, simply remove the seeds and white membranes before slicing. For a bolder kick, leave some or all of the seeds intact.
- Tequila: The heart of any great margarita! Use your favorite brand of tequila. Both Blanco (silver) and Reposado tequilas work beautifully in this recipe. Blanco offers a clean, crisp agave flavor that lets the mango shine, while Reposado adds a subtle oakiness. For an adventurous twist, consider using Mezcal to introduce a smoky element that complements the mango’s sweetness.
- Triple Sec: This orange liqueur adds a crucial citrusy sweetness to the margarita. While premium options like Cointreau or Grand Marnier are excellent, a good quality triple sec is perfectly suitable and more budget-friendly. It’s a versatile staple for many cocktails.
- Lime Juice: Freshly squeezed lime juice makes a world of difference! Its bright, zesty acidity perfectly balances the sweetness of the mango and simple syrup. For individual servings, squeezing fresh limes is worth the effort. If you’re preparing a large batch, opting for a high-quality bottled lime juice from your liquor or grocery store can save a lot of time and hand strain.
- Simple Syrup: This acts as a sweetener, harmonizing the flavors. You can easily purchase simple syrup at most grocery or liquor stores, but it’s incredibly simple and economical to make at home with just sugar and water.
- Seasoning: For the rim of your glass, a chili spice blend adds an extra layer of flavor and heat. I highly recommend Savory Spice’s Chilean Merquen Seasoning for its unique profile, but Tajin is a fantastic and widely available alternative. You can also create your own chili spice mixture using chili powder, a pinch of cayenne, and a touch of salt.

Seasonal Mango Selection Tip
For the absolute best flavor in your spicy mango margarita, selecting a perfectly ripe mango is key. Gently squeeze the mango – if it gives slightly to pressure, much like a ripe avocado, it’s ready to be enjoyed. If the mango feels hard, it needs more time to ripen. You can accelerate this process by placing an unripe mango in a brown paper bag at room temperature; it should ripen within a few days.

How to Craft the Perfect Spicy Mango Margarita
Making this vibrant cocktail is simpler than you might think. Follow these easy steps for a perfectly balanced and flavorful drink:
Muddle for Maximum Flavor
Begin by preparing your cocktail glass. Take a lime wedge and run it around the rim of your chosen glass. Then, dip the rim into your preferred chili seasoning (like Tajin or Savory Spice’s Chilean Merquen Seasoning) to create a beautiful and flavorful edge. Next, in the bottom of a sturdy cocktail shaker, combine the diced mango chunks and jalapeño slices. Use a muddler to thoroughly crush the mixture. You want to break down the mango completely, releasing all its sweet, juicy pulp and allowing the jalapeño’s spice to infuse into the fruit.
Shake to Perfection
Once the mango and jalapeño are well muddled and fragrant, add the remaining liquid ingredients to the shaker: tequila, triple sec, fresh lime juice, and simple syrup. Fill the shaker generously with ice cubes. Secure the lid tightly and shake vigorously for about 15-20 seconds. This not only chills the drink but also thoroughly combines all the flavors, creating a harmonious and refreshing cocktail. The vigorous shaking also helps to slightly dilute the drink, enhancing its drinkability.
Strain and Serve
Carefully remove the lid from the shaker. Using a cocktail strainer, strain the delicious liquid into your prepared glass, which should already be filled with fresh ice. This ensures a smooth drink free from any mango pulp or jalapeño pieces. Finally, garnish your Spicy Mango Margarita as desired – a slice of fresh mango, a lime wheel, or even a dehydrated lime slice will add a touch of elegance. Serve immediately and enjoy the delightful sweet and spicy kick!
Pro Tip! Elevate your presentation by dipping a fresh slice of mango in the same seasoning you used for the rim. This not only reinforces the flavor profile but also creates a stunning and unique garnish. Pair it with a dehydrated lime slice for an even more sophisticated look that truly stands out.

Expert Tips for Spicy Mango Margarita Perfection
To ensure your spicy mango margaritas are nothing short of spectacular, keep these key tips in mind:
- Use Fresh Ingredients for Vibrant Flavor: This cannot be stressed enough – the success of this margarita hinges on the freshness of your ingredients. Always opt for FRESH lime juice and ripe, fresh mango. Bottled lime juice, while convenient for large batches, simply doesn’t deliver the same bright, zesty punch as fresh. The natural sweetness and vibrant acidity of fresh ingredients will make your cocktail truly pop and distinguish it from mediocre versions.
- Scale Up for a Crowd with Ease: Planning a party or a gathering? This recipe is incredibly adaptable for large batches! Simply multiply the ingredient quantities by the number of servings you need. For detailed instructions on preparing a big batch, check out our dedicated FAQ section below, and you’ll also find specific measurements at the bottom of the recipe card.
- Adjust the Spice Level: Not everyone loves a strong kick, and that’s perfectly fine! If you prefer a milder spice, or no spice at all, simply remove the seeds and white membranes from the jalapeño before muddling, or reduce the amount of jalapeño used. For a completely non-spicy mango margarita, you can omit the jalapeño entirely. The mango, lime, and tequila combination is still wonderfully refreshing and delicious on its own.
- Chill Your Glasses: For an extra-cold and long-lasting drink, place your cocktail glasses in the freezer for about 15-20 minutes before serving. A chilled glass helps to keep your margarita colder for longer, enhancing the refreshing experience without excessive ice dilution.
- Taste and Adjust: Every mango is slightly different in sweetness, and personal preferences vary. After shaking, take a small taste of your margarita. If you find it too tart, add a little more simple syrup. If it’s too sweet, a splash more lime juice can balance it out. Don’t be afraid to adjust to your perfect flavor profile!

Can I Use Cointreau Instead of Triple Sec in a Margarita?
Absolutely, yes! The choice between Cointreau and triple sec (or Grand Marnier) in a margarita often comes down to personal preference and budget. While I often opt for triple sec for its affordability and versatility in various cocktails, Cointreau is a premium brand of triple sec and a fantastic choice for margaritas. It has a smoother, more refined orange flavor and less sweetness than many standard triple secs, which can elevate your cocktail significantly. Grand Marnier, an orange-flavored cognac liqueur, offers an even richer, more complex taste. Feel free to use whichever orange liqueur you prefer and have on hand – each will contribute its own unique character to your spicy mango margarita.
Choosing the Perfect Rim: Salt, Sugar, or Spice?
For a spicy margarita like this one, my strong preference is for a chili spice blend on the rim, such as Tajin or Savory Spice’s Chilean Merquen Seasoning. This perfectly complements the internal spice from the jalapeño and the sweetness of the mango, adding another dimension of flavor and a gentle kick with every sip. While you could use traditional salt, I find the spicy seasoning creates a more cohesive and exciting experience. I generally do not recommend using a sugar rim for this particular drink. The ripe mango already brings a lovely natural sweetness to the cocktail, and adding more sugar to the rim might make it overly sweet, overshadowing the intricate balance of flavors we’re aiming for.
Can I Make a Big Batch of Spicy Mango Margaritas?
Yes, absolutely! Making a big batch of spicy mango margaritas is a fantastic idea for entertaining, saving you time and ensuring everyone gets to enjoy this delicious cocktail. To prepare a batch that serves approximately 8 people, you’ll need: 8 mangos (peeled and chopped), 8 jalapeños (remember, remove the seeds to reduce spice, or use only half the quantity if you prefer a milder drink), 2 cups of tequila, 1 cup of triple sec, 1 1/2 cups of fresh lime juice, and 3/4 cup of simple syrup.
The easiest way to prepare this larger quantity is to first combine the chopped mango, jalapeño, and lime juice in a powerful blender or food processor. Blend until the mixture is smooth and well combined. Then, strain this mango-jalapeño puree into a large pitcher to remove any fibrous bits. Stir in the tequila, triple sec, and simple syrup. Chill the mixture in the refrigerator until you’re ready to serve. When it’s time to enjoy, simply pour over ice in individual rimmed glasses.
Can I Use Frozen Mango?
Yes, you can use frozen mango, but with a slight caveat. While fresh mango offers the most vibrant flavor and ideal texture, frozen mango can be a convenient alternative when fresh isn’t in season or readily available. However, I often find that frozen mango lacks the intense sweetness and nuanced flavor of ripe, fresh mango. If you choose to use frozen mango, ensure you thaw it completely before incorporating it into your cocktail. After thawing, it’s crucial to drain any excess liquid that has accumulated. This prevents the margarita from becoming too watery and ensures the flavors remain concentrated. Once thawed and drained, proceed with the recipe as you would with fresh mango.

Ingredients
- 1 mango peeled and diced, for fresh flavor
- 1 jalapeño sliced (remove seeds to reduce spice, or leave for more heat)
- 2 oz tequila your preferred brand; blanco is recommended for a crisp taste
- 1 oz triple sec or Cointreau for a premium orange liqueur flavor
- 1 1/2 oz fresh lime juice freshly squeezed for best results
- 3/4 oz simple syrup adjust to your desired sweetness
- Tajin seasoning or your favorite chili spice blend, for rimming the glass
- garnish: lime wheel dehydrated, or a fresh slice of mango dipped in seasoning
Instructions
-
Prepare your cocktail glass: Rub the rim with a lime wedge, then dip it into Tajin seasoning (or your chosen chili spice mixture) to coat evenly.
-
In the bottom of a cocktail shaker, add the diced mango and sliced jalapeño. Muddle them thoroughly until the mango has broken down and released its juices, and the jalapeño’s flavor is incorporated.
-
Add the tequila, triple sec, fresh lime juice, and simple syrup to the shaker. Fill the shaker with ice.
-
Shake vigorously for 15-20 seconds until well chilled and thoroughly mixed.
-
Strain the cocktail into your prepared glass, which should be filled with fresh ice.
-
Garnish with a slice of fresh mango (optionally dipped in seasoning) and a lime wheel. Serve immediately and enjoy!
